There are only HB and F type pencils in the store. The ratio of the number of HB to F is 3 : 2. If there are 12F type pencils, how many pencils are there altogether?

Let's put this as a proportion below and solve.

[tex] \frac{HP}{F} =\frac{3}{2} =\frac{HP}{12} [/tex]

To solve for HP, we can see that we multiplied 2 by 6 to get to 12. We can do the same for 3.

3(6)=18

Just to check, we can cross multiply.

2x=36

x=18

Now we add.

18+12=30

Therefore, there are 30 pencils.
